Why Does Mold Grow So Easily in Sheds, Barns, and Garages on Agricultural Properties?
Mold thrives in outbuildings because these structures often trap moisture and limit airflow. Agricultural properties in Vineland typically feature barns, sheds, and detached garages filled with wood, hay, tools, and other organic materials. These substances provide a perfect food source for mold, especially when moisture is present.
Key reasons mold growth in outbuildings occurs include:
- Poor ventilation and airflow: Many barns and sheds were not designed with continuous airflow, creating stagnant, humid environments where spores thrive.
- Organic building materials: Wood, cardboard, hay, and other materials store moisture, allowing mold to colonize quickly.
- Exposure to moisture: Rainwater, melting snow, and high humidity contribute to persistent dampness in and around structures.
- Vineland farming environment: Equipment and stored materials are often kept in semi-exposed conditions, increasing contact with outdoor moisture.
By understanding these contributing factors, property owners can identify high-risk areas and take preventative steps before mold spreads to more critical structures.
Can Mold from an Outbuilding Spread to Nearby Structures Like Homes or Workshops?
Yes, mold in a barn, shed, or garage doesn’t stay confined. Airborne spores are light and travel easily, particularly in open agricultural layouts common in Vineland. Even structures separated by yards or small fields are at risk of cross-contamination.
Mold can spread to nearby buildings through several pathways:
- Airborne spores: Wind carries spores from one building to another, often entering through vents, windows, or small cracks.
- Proximity of structures: Closely spaced barns, workshops, and homes allow spores to settle on surfaces in multiple locations.
- Cross-contamination via tools and equipment: Items moved between buildings, like wheelbarrows, tractors, or hand tools, can carry spores with them.
- Foot traffic: Workers and farmhands can unknowingly transport spores on clothing or footwear.
On large agricultural properties, the open layout that is ideal for farming can inadvertently create channels for mold spread. Preventing contamination requires a property-wide approach, rather than focusing solely on one building.
How Does Mold Spread Between Buildings on Large Properties?
Mold doesn’t just jump from one building to another randomly. Its movement is influenced by airflow, shared moisture sources, and repeated exposure to contaminated materials.
Some of the most common pathways for mold spread include:
- Wind patterns: Seasonal winds can carry spores across barns, sheds, and homes, especially when structures have openings or gaps.
- Shared drainage or damp soil areas: Water pooling near multiple buildings creates a bridge for mold, especially during Vineland’s rainy seasons.
- Equipment and stored items: Spreading mold through hay bales, wood planks, or farm tools is common if items are stored in multiple structures.
- Seasonal conditions: Humidity peaks in summer and early fall increase mold’s ability to spread, making consistent monitoring essential.
Understanding these pathways helps property owners focus mitigation efforts on areas where mold transfer is most likely, preventing a localized problem from escalating into a property-wide concern.
What Are the Signs Mold Growth in Outbuildings Is Affecting Other Structures?
Identifying early warning signs is critical to stopping mold before it damages multiple structures. Look for the following indicators across your Vineland property:
- Musty odors: Persistent, earthy smells in nearby homes or workshops can signal airborne mold.
- Visible mold in multiple buildings: Black, green, or white growth appearing in more than one structure is a red flag.
- Increased indoor humidity: Homes adjacent to moldy outbuildings may experience higher moisture levels indoors.
- Contaminated stored items: Tools, clothing, or materials that develop mold in multiple locations show cross-contamination.
Regular inspections, particularly during humid summer months, can reveal mold activity before it spreads extensively. Property owners should pay attention not only to the original outbuilding but also to any structures within the potential spore travel zone.
How Can Property Owners Stop Mold Growth in Outbuildings and Prevent It from Spreading?
Preventing mold spread requires proactive steps to manage moisture, improve ventilation, and address existing mold at the source. Implementing a property-wide plan helps protect all structures from the domino effect of contamination.
Key strategies include:
- Improve airflow and ventilation: Installing vents, fans, or windows in barns, sheds, and garages reduces humidity and discourages mold growth.
- Eliminate standing water: Grade the land around structures, repair leaky roofs, and address pooling water near foundations.
- Clean and treat affected materials: Remove moldy items promptly and consider professional treatment for extensive contamination.
- Monitor all structures: Check homes, workshops, and storage areas, not just the original outbuilding, for early signs of mold.
- Maintain ongoing prevention: Mold can return during periods of high humidity; consistent monitoring and maintenance are essential.
Implementing these steps can significantly reduce the risk of mold spreading across agricultural properties. Early action protects not only the outbuildings but also homes, workshops, and equipment critical to farm operations.
